SWIR cameras are used as a standalone device as well as integrated with different devices used in security and surveillance, military, machine vision, photovoltaics, medical, spectroscopy, thermography, telecommunication, and instrumentation. They are used to detect radiation, which is invisible to human eyes, and capture it. SWIR cameras, such as cooled and uncooled cameras, are extensively used in the residential, commercial, military, and industrial manufacturing sectors, because of their low price, lightweight quality, and low-power consumption.
The global Shortwave Infrared (SWIR) Camera market is projected to grow from US$ 162.9 million in 2024 to US$ 267.3 million by 2030, at a Compound Annual Growth Rate (CAGR) of 8.6% during the forecast period.
SWIR cameras are prominently used in several production processes in industrial manufacturing to check product quality, performance, and monitoring and for the thermal imaging of hot objects. Additionally, these infrared cameras are also used by the metal and glass industries for process and quality systems and by the paper manufacturing industry to determine the dryness of the paper, since these cameras can detect moisture.
